本发明专利技术实施例提供一种实现高精度地图功能扩展的方法及装置。其中,方法包括:将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。本发明专利技术实施例提供的方法及装置,通过将高精度地图与传统web地图进行叠加,完善了传统web地图的精度问题,传统web地图与高精度地图叠加两者互补,用户通过叠加的高精度web地图,可以进行基于基础功能的拓展服务,精确的展示特定区域的具体细节。
The method and device of realizing the function expansion of high precision map
【技术实现步骤摘要】
实现高精度地图功能扩展的方法及装置
本专利技术涉及高精度地图
,尤其涉及一种实现高精度地图功能扩展的方法及装置。
技术介绍
现如今,人们的出行越来越频繁,针对特定区域的地图服务也越来越重要,随着高精度数据的技术日渐成熟,对于特定区域地图服务的优势也日益突出。相比于传统web地图,高精度地图的精度更高,能够精确展示特定区域的具体细节。然而,相比于传统web地图,高精度地图还具有一些缺陷,例如,功能无法拓展,即无法进行高精度定位、高精度地图区域实时监控以及实时更新等。
技术实现思路
针对现有技术存在的问题,本专利技术实施例提供一种实现高精度地图功能扩展的方法及装置。第一方面,本专利技术实施例提供一种实现高精度地图功能扩展的方法,包括:将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。进一步地,将特定区域的高精度地图和传统web地图进行叠加,具体包括:采集所述特定区域的高精度地图数据;将所述高精度地图数据进行数据编译及数据生产后上传到云服务器;从所述云服务器下载所述特定区域的高精度地图数据和传统web地图数据;将所述高精度地图数据对应的地图图层与所述传统web地图数据对应的地图图层进行叠加。进一步地,所述特定区域的高精度地图数据通过采集车采集得到。进一步地,将所述高精度地图数据进行数据编译及数据生产后上传到云服务器,具体包括:将采集得到的KHB格式的高精度地图数据通过编译工具编译成mapbox引擎支持的KHI格式的高精度地图数据;将所述KHI格式的高精度地图数据通过web工具转换生产成所述mapbox引擎能够识别的数据并上传至所述云服务器。第二方面,本专利技术实施例提供一种实现高精度地图功能扩展的装置,包括:叠加模块,用于将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。进一步地,叠加模块,具体包括:采集单元,用于采集所述特定区域的高精度地图数据;上传单元,用于将所述高精度地图数据进行数据编译及数据生产后上传到云服务器;下载单元,用于从所述云服务器下载所述特定区域的高精度地图数据和传统web地图数据;叠加单元,用于将所述高精度地图数据对应的地图图层与所述传统web地图数据对应的地图图层进行叠加。进一步地,所述特定区域的高精度地图数据通过采集车采集得到。进一步地,上传单元,具体包括:编译部件,用于将采集得到的KHB格式的高精度地图数据通过编译工具编译成mapbox引擎支持的KHI格式的高精度地图数据;生产部件,用于将所述KHI格式的高精度地图数据通过web工具转换生产成所述mapbox引擎能够识别的数据并上传至所述云服务器。第三方面,本专利技术实施例提供一种电子设备,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现如第一方面所提供的方法的步骤。第四方面,本专利技术实施例提供一种非暂态计算机可读存储介质,其上存储有计算机程序,该计算机程序被处理器执行时实现如第一方面所提供的方法的步骤。本专利技术实施例提供的实现高精度地图功能扩展的方法及装置,通过将高精度地图与传统web地图进行叠加,完善了传统web地图的精度问题,传统web地图与高精度地图叠加两者互补,用户通过叠加的高精度web地图,可以进行基于基础功能的拓展服务,精确的展示特定区域的具体细节。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的一种实现高精度地图功能扩展的方法流程图;图2为本专利技术实施例提供的一种实现高精度地图功能扩展的装置的结构示意图;图3为本专利技术实施例提供的一种电子设备的实体结构示意图。具体实施方式为使本专利技术实施例的目的、技术方案和优点更加清楚,下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。图1为本专利技术实施例提供的一种实现高精度地图功能扩展的方法流程图,如图1所述,该方法包括:步骤101,将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。具体地,本专利技术实施例中的特定区域为校园、停车场或商业园区等,本专利技术实施例对其不做具体限定。通过采集车采集特定区域的高精度地图数据,并将高精度地图数据对应的图层与传统web地图的图层进行叠加,通过高精度地图可以实时的显示特定区域的细节,通过传统web地图的API可以完成更多的功能拓展,例如高精度定位、高精度地图区域的实时监控以及实时更新等。本专利技术实施例提供的方法,通过将高精度地图与传统web地图进行叠加,完善了传统web地图的精度问题,传统web地图与高精度地图叠加两者互补,用户通过叠加的高精度web地图,可以进行基于基础功能的拓展服务,精确的展示特定区域的具体细节。在上述实施例的基础上,将特定区域的高精度地图和传统web地图进行叠加,具体包括:步骤1011,采集所述特定区域的高精度地图数据;具体地,本专利技术实施例中的特定区域为校园、停车场或商业园区等,本专利技术实施例对其不做具体限定。特定区域的高精度地图数据通过采集车采集。步骤1012,将所述高精度地图数据进行数据编译及数据生产后上传到云服务器;具体地,采集到的高精度地图数据为KHB格式的,将KHB格式的高精度地图数据通过编译工具编译生成mapbox引擎支持的数据类型,例如,KHI格式的高精度地图数据。然后,将KHI格式的高精度地图数据通过web工具转换生产成mapbox引擎可以识别的数据并上传到云服务器。步骤1013,从所述云服务器下载所述特定区域的高精度地图数据和传统web地图数据;步骤1014,将所述高精度地图数据对应的地图图层与所述传统web地图数据对应的地图图层进行叠加。具体地,传统web地图通过从云服务器下载到本地,通过API方法调用展示传统web地图,并将高精度数据的地图图层叠加到传统web地图。通过完整的api文档可以实现定制化的功能拓展,多图层的叠加,通过感知数据的实时变化以及云服务器服务器的交互实时更新特定区域的实时显示的更新。定位图层的叠加,显示区域内实时动态情本文档来自技高网...
【技术保护点】
1.一种实现高精度地图功能扩展的方法,其特征在于,包括:/n将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。/n
【技术特征摘要】
1.一种实现高精度地图功能扩展的方法,其特征在于,包括:
将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域的细节,并通过所述传统web地图的API完成功能拓展。
2.根据权利要求1所述的方法,其特征在于,将特定区域的高精度地图和传统web地图进行叠加,具体包括:
采集所述特定区域的高精度地图数据;
将所述高精度地图数据进行数据编译及数据生产后上传到云服务器;
从所述云服务器下载所述特定区域的高精度地图数据和传统web地图数据;
将所述高精度地图数据对应的地图图层与所述传统web地图数据对应的地图图层进行叠加。
3.根据权利要求2所述的方法,其特征在于,所述特定区域的高精度地图数据通过采集车采集得到。
4.根据权利要求2所述的方法,其特征在于,将所述高精度地图数据进行数据编译及数据生产后上传到云服务器,具体包括:
将采集得到的KHB格式的高精度地图数据通过编译工具编译成mapbox引擎支持的KHI格式的高精度地图数据;
将所述KHI格式的高精度地图数据通过web工具转换生产成所述mapbox引擎能够识别的数据并上传至所述云服务器。
5.一种实现高精度地图功能扩展的装置,其特征在于,包括:
叠加模块,用于将特定区域的高精度地图和传统web地图进行叠加,以通过所述高精度地图实时显示所述特定区域...
【专利技术属性】
技术研发人员:孙攀,程飞,苏珽,刘奋,
申请(专利权)人:武汉中海庭数据技术有限公司,
类型:发明
国别省市:湖北;42
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。